Fan-out backpressure for the Quillet notifier: when the queue depth crosses the soft limit, the dispatcher sheds low-priority pushes and batches the rest at 500ms intervals. Reviewer should confirm the shed counter is exported and that retries respect the jitter window. Once merged, the release artifact gets re-signed by the pipeline, which expects the deploy key shown below.

deploy key for bawep-yawif: bky6_GQhaSt

**Ticket: Config drift on Loomwork migration**

While moving the nightly cron jobs onto the Loomwork workflow engine, we found three workers still reading stale settings from the old Fernrose host. Retries behave differently depending on which box picks up the job — fun. Before Thursday's sync, please diff your local setup against the canonical configuration values below.

deployment values, yadug-bawif:
[framir]
team = pelox
access_code = ac_a38ab2
owner = tamion.julael
host = framir.tolvaqlabs.test
port = 11211
peer = tammir.zemvargrid.local
salt = 2215ef03
pin = 1541

Onboarding note for the Ledgerpane admin table: bulk edits are applied through the batcher service, not directly against the database. Select rows, choose an action, and the batcher stages changes in a pending set you can review before commit. Edits over 500 rows require a second approver — this is enforced server-side, so don't try to chunk around it. To run the batcher locally you need the staging write credential, which goes in your .env as the next line.

secret setting of bahip-kagag: RELAY_SECRET3=c83

### Authentication

The Haulferry fuel-usage report is generated nightly by the `fleetledger-reporter` job, which aggregates pump readings from each depot and writes a signed CSV to the reporting bucket. For review purposes: the job authenticates to the internal Fleetledger API with a scoped, read-only credential; it cannot modify odometer or fuel records. Transport is TLS-only, and the credential is rotated every 90 days by the platform team. The reporter presents the following key on every request to the Fleetledger gateway.

service key, fawip-bajef: kto11_Qt5wZK9vdNC